Transaction 76db4410bad18d93fa08fa3cc2d34862c0100a7cbfb86f4a1d911d7fefa742e8
1 Input
1 Output
-
76db4410bad18d93fa08fa3cc2d34862c0100a7cbfb86f4a1d911d7fefa742e8:0
- value
- 10921
- script pubkey
- OP_0 OP_PUSHBYTES_20 868f7b23fa4037463324f1b5d9ab39d870362297
- address
- bc1qs68hkgl6gqm5vvey7x6an2eempcrvg5hm2nfvz